There comes a time, in every lucky woman’s life, where she gets to drive the brand new Range Rover. For a whole week. This was my first foray into Rangey territory, and I got to test the new model, the Velar which is bigger than the Evoque, but smaller than the Sport. 

With so much going on at home – Christmas coming, the school term finishing, plus playdates, ballet concerts and swimming lessons coming out of my ears, I decided this week I needed to focus on me – to get healthy and re-energise for the busy weeks to come. And I had the Range Rover Velar for the challenge.

It was, quite simply, a pleasure to drive. Smooth and so so quiet, with an incredible 17 speakers so you can literally have a party in the car. I was stuck in traffic directly under the flight path where the planes are so low it feels like they’re flying through the trees, but all I had to do was shut the windows, turn the music up a bit and it honestly felt like I was in my living room. Stealth. Think of it like the car version of The Rock. Strong and solid, but gosh it looks good in a suit and can get around surprisingly quickly.

It’s got excellent interior space without compromising on agility while driving and parking, and has a luxurious feeling that lasts long after you exit the car. The advanced technology and attention to detail is fabulous.
